Rodney M. Anderson
Rodney "Andy" M. Anderson, 58, of Chetek, passed away Thursday, Oct. 22, 2009, at his home.
He was born March 23, 1951, to V. Gilman and Yvonne (Bailkey) Anderson. Rod lived in Chetek all his life. He married Rose Rakovec, from Greenwood, June 18, 1988, at the Chetek Lutheran Church.

After graduating from Chetek High School in 1969, Rod attended college at UW-Stout in Menomonie and later continued his education in the insurance field. He also taught several classes for new agents.

Rod worked as an insurance agent for Rural Mutual Insurance in Cameron for 20 years. He worked at the Indianhead Insurance Agency in Chetek for the last 20 years.

Rod enjoyed hunting with his buddies of many years at the Webb cabin, in Barnes. Many fishing trips were enjoyed in Northern Wisconsin, Minnesota and Canada. He played football and baseball in high school and college. Later Rod enjoyed watching the Packers and Badgers play.

Rod was a member of the Chetek Lutheran Church in Chetek.

Rod is survived by his wife, Rose, of Chetek; mother, Yvonne Anderson, of Chetek; two sisters, Vicki Clark, of Cameron, and Jo (Scott) Colby, of Chetek; two nieces, Michelle Clark and Andee Colby, both of Cameron; two nephews, Joseph (Jessica) Clark, of Chetek, and Mitch (Mandi) Colby, of Eau Claire; three sisters-in-law, Pat (Alden) Dahl, of Stanley, Joan (Ken) Severson, of Greenwood, and Linda (David) Lawcewicz, of Thorp; five brothers-in-law, Jerry (Teresa) Rakovec, of Withee, Mike (Connie) Rakovec, of Loyal, Gene (Lonna) Rakovec, of Greenwood, Cyril (Rose) Rakovec, of Pittsville, and Randy Rakovec, of Greenwood; a great-niece, Alexis Clark, of Chetek; great-nephew, Charles Clark, of Chetek; godson, James Moon, of Chetek; and many nieces, nephews, great-nieces and great-nephews from the Greenwood area.

He was preceded in death by his father, V. Gilman Anderson; and brother-in-law, Charles J. Clark.

Funeral services were held Tuesday at Chetek Lutheran Church. Burial was at Lake View Cemetery in Chetek.
